Read allFather and Mother are much pleased to see Peter, a well-to-do young man, making love to their daughter Mary, but upon learning from his wife that he will need to stand the $1,250 for the wedding, Father decides that if he withholds his consent, Mary and Peter will elope and save him all that money.
